引言
随着大数据时代的到来,数据处理和分析的需求日益增长。传统的计算框架已经无法满足日益复杂的数据处理需求。多维度计算框架作为一种新兴的计算模式,正逐渐成为数据处理领域的研究热点。本文将深入探讨多维度计算框架的原理、应用以及未来发展趋势,旨在帮助读者了解这一技术,并为其在数据处理领域的应用提供指导。
一、多维度计算框架概述
1.1 定义
多维度计算框架是指在多维数据空间中对数据进行存储、处理和分析的计算模式。它突破了传统计算框架在数据维度和计算能力上的限制,能够高效地处理大规模、高维度的数据。
1.2 特点
- 高维数据支持:多维度计算框架能够处理高维数据,满足复杂业务场景的需求。
- 高效计算:采用分布式计算、并行计算等技术,提高数据处理效率。
- 灵活扩展:支持动态扩展,适应不同规模的数据处理需求。
- 跨平台兼容:支持多种硬件和软件平台,具有良好的兼容性。
二、多维度计算框架原理
2.1 数据存储
多维度计算框架采用分布式文件系统(如Hadoop HDFS)进行数据存储。分布式文件系统将数据分散存储在多个节点上,提高数据存储的可靠性和扩展性。
2.2 数据处理
多维度计算框架采用分布式计算框架(如Apache Spark)进行数据处理。分布式计算框架将计算任务分配到多个节点上并行执行,提高数据处理效率。
2.3 数据分析
多维度计算框架采用机器学习、数据挖掘等技术进行数据分析。通过分析数据,挖掘有价值的信息,为业务决策提供支持。
三、多维度计算框架应用
3.1 互联网领域
在互联网领域,多维度计算框架广泛应用于搜索引擎、推荐系统、广告投放等场景。例如,通过分析用户行为数据,为用户推荐个性化内容。
3.2 金融领域
在金融领域,多维度计算框架可用于风险管理、信用评估、投资决策等场景。通过分析海量金融数据,为金融机构提供决策支持。
3.3 医疗领域
在医疗领域,多维度计算框架可用于疾病预测、药物研发、医疗资源优化等场景。通过分析医疗数据,提高医疗服务质量。
四、多维度计算框架发展趋势
4.1 软硬件协同优化
随着硬件技术的发展,多维度计算框架将更加注重软硬件协同优化,提高数据处理效率。
4.2 智能化分析
多维度计算框架将结合人工智能技术,实现智能化数据分析,为用户提供更精准的决策支持。
4.3 跨领域融合
多维度计算框架将与其他领域技术(如物联网、区块链等)融合,拓展应用场景。
五、总结
多维度计算框架作为一种新兴的计算模式,在数据处理领域具有广阔的应用前景。通过深入了解多维度计算框架的原理、应用和发展趋势,有助于我们更好地把握这一技术,为未来数据处理提供有力支持。
